Введите имя домена:
.ua .com.ua .in.ua .org.ua
.ru .com .net .org
Показать все домены

Создание нового пользователя с правами root

Ответы на вопросы от компании «Украинский хостинг».

Как добавить пользователя с правами root в CentOS 7

В ОС CentOS 7 по умолчанию создается только один пользователь - root, работать и администрировать систему из под которого категорически не рекомендуется.

В связи с этим рекомендуется создать обычного пользователя и при необходимости добавить его в группу wheels, разрешающую выполнение программ от имени суперпользователя при помощи команды sudo.

Процедура создания нового пользователя с правами root состоит из следующих этапов:

  1. Подключаемся под root (см. подключение по SSH)
  2. Cоздаем пользователя (вместо username указать свое имя пользователя):
    adduser username
  3. Задаем пользователю пароль (вместо username указать свое имя пользователя):
    passwd username
  4. Добавляем пользователя в группу wheel (вместо username указать свое имя пользователя):
    usermod -aG wheel username
  5. В примере используется текстовый редактор nano, для установки которого требуется выполнить команду:
    yum install nano
  6. Открываем в текстовом редакторе файл /etc/sudoers
    nano /etc/sudoers
  7. В конец файла добавляем строку (вместо username указать свое имя пользователя):
    username ALL=(ALL) ALL
    Сохраняем изменение в файле, нажав сочетание клавиш Ctrl+x , затем клавишу y и затем клавишу Enter
  8. Переходим в сессию нового пользователя (вместо username указать свое имя пользователя):
    su - username
  9. Теперь пробуем выполнить любую команду, добавив перед ней sudo. Для примера:
    sudo ls -la /root
  10. При первом запуске sudo система запросит пароль текущей учётной записи.

После этого команда будет выполнена с правами администратора.

См.также: